What Equipment Should You Prepare?

For the tools needed to make the Cranberry Orange Cupcakes, you will need muffin trays, a small bowl, a whisk, a zester, and a piping bag. With these few tools, you can already begin baking your cupcakes for your loving guests.

What Ingredients Should You Need?

To make the Cranberry Orange Cupcakes, you will need the following: all-purpose flour, baking powder, salt, white sugar, vegetable oil, eggs, vanilla extract, whole milk, orange zest, and cranberries. Also, you can use half vanilla extract and half orange extract or a few drops of orange oil, if you have it. 

Meanwhile, for the frosting of the cupcakes, you will need to prepare butter, powdered icing sugar, orange juice, and zest if you want to. These two ingredients are optional depending on your taste.

Now, for the sugared cranberries toppings, you will need 18 cranberries, water, and sugar. Once you have these ingredients, you can already create the perfect attractive topping for the cupcakes.

Cranberry Orange Cupcake

Course Dessert
Cuisine American

Equipment

  • Muffin trays
  • Small bowl
  • Whisk
  • Zester
  • Piping bag 

Ingredients
  

  • 1 1/4 cup All-Purpose Flour
  • 1 1/2 teaspoons Baking Powder
  • 1 teaspoon Salt
  • 1 cup White Sugar
  • 1/2 cup Vegetable Oil
  • 2 Eggs room temperature
  • 2 teaspoons Vanilla Extract*
  • 1 cup Whole Milk
  • Zest of One Orange about 1 1/2 Tablespoons
  • 1 cup Cranberries

Frosting:

  • 1 cup Butter
  • 5-6 cups Powdered Icing Sugar
  • 3 Tablespoons Orange Juice as desired
  • Orange Zest as desired

Sugared Cranberries:

  • 18 Cranberries
  • 1/2 cup Water
  • 1/2 cup White Sugar

Instructions
 

  • Preheat oven to 350F.
  • Line two muffin trays with 18 muffin liners. Set aside.
  • In a small bowl, whisk together the flour, baking powder and salt. Set aside.
  • In a large bowl, beat together the sugar and oil until light and fully combined, about 2 minutes.
  • Beat in eggs, vanilla extract and milk.
  • Add the flour in gradually until well-combined and no lumps remain. Add orange zest and cran
  • berries and stir to distribute.
  • Portion the cupcake batter into the prepared liners, filling each about 2/3 of the way full.
  • Bake cupcakes for 18-22 minutes, until lightly golden and an inserted toothpick or cake tester
  • comes out clean.
  • While the cupcakes cool, prepare your frosting.
  • Beat together the butter, powdered sugar and orange juice for 2 minutes until light and forming
  • stiff peaks. Adjust flavor with additional orange juice or zest. Adjust consistency with more
  • powdered sugar for a stiffer frosting, or more juice for a softer frosting.
  • Scoop the frosting into a piping bag fitted with a large star tip. Pipe the frosting onto the cooled
  • cupcakes, starting in the center, working your way out to the edges and then back towards the
  • center and up.
  • Dip each cranberry in the water then roll in the white sugar.
  • Garnish each cupcake with a cranberry
